摘要: 目的 针对高温地区重载重交通的二级公路,制备一种陶瓷-钢渣阻热耐磨型沥青混合料,对其路用性能进行研究。方法 将粒径4.75~9.5 mm的陶瓷和钢渣等体积代替同档位石灰岩集料的40%,陶瓷和钢渣的掺配比例分别设置为2:2、1:3和3:1。通过冻融劈裂试验、车辙试验评价该混合料的水稳定性和高温稳定性,通过室内光照辐射试验和加速磨耗试验验证混合料的阻热性能和耐磨性能。结果 结果表明:陶瓷和钢渣的加入会导致混合料的沥青用量增加,且陶瓷-钢渣沥青混合料水稳定性和抗车辙性能均有不同程度提高;陶瓷-钢渣沥青混合料降温效果比较显著,但长时间高温照射也会使上表面温度增加,且当二者掺量为2:2时在4 cm面层的最大温差为5.9 ℃,阻热效果最好;钢渣强度高,表面粗糙度多孔,与沥青结合牢固,其掺量对耐磨性能的影响较大,且随着钢渣掺量增加,耐磨性能提高得越显著,当钢渣掺量为30% 时,试件在加速磨耗试验中的质量损失最低,为227.1 g,耐磨性能相比于常规纯石灰岩沥青混合料提高了25.10%。结论 根据掺配比例不同导致沥青混合料性能变化规律不同,建议陶瓷-钢渣掺量比例控制在2:2左右,沥青混合料综合性能最优,且便于施工配料。

关键词: 陶瓷;钢渣;沥青混合料;阻热性能;耐磨性能

Abstract: Objectives For secondary highways with heavy traffic in high-temperature areas, a ceramic-steel slag heat-resistant and wear-resistant asphalt mixture was prepared, and its pavement performance was studied. Methods Ceramic and steel slag with particle sizes ranging from 4.75mm to 9.5mm were used to replace 40% of the equivalent-grade limestone aggregate by volume, with ceramic and steel slag mixing ratios set at 2:2, 1:3, and 3:1, respectively. The water stability and high-temperature stability of the mixture were evaluated through freeze-thaw splitting tests and rutting tests, while its heat resistance and wear resistance were verified through indoor light radiation tests and accelerated wear tests. Results The results show that the addition of ceramic and steel slag increases the asphalt content of the mixture, and the ceramic-steel slag asphalt mixture exhibits varying degrees of improvement in water stability and rutting resistance. The cooling effect of the ceramic-steel slag asphalt mixture is relatively significant, but prolonged high-temperature exposure also increases the surface temperature. When the mixing ratio of ceramic and steel slag is 2:2, the maximum temperature difference at the 4cm surface layer is 5.9°C, indicating the best heat resistance effect. Steel slag has high strength, a rough and porous surface, and forms a strong bond with asphalt. Its content significantly affects wear resistance, with the wear resistance improving more significantly as the steel slag content increases. When the steel slag content is 30%, the test specimen has the lowest mass loss in the accelerated wear test, at 227.1g, which is a 25.10% improvement over conventional pure limestone asphalt mixtures. Conclusions Based on the different performance changes resulting from varying mixing ratios, it is recommended that the ceramic-steel slag mixing ratio be controlled at approximately 2:2, which optimizes the overall performance of the asphalt mixture and facilitates construction and material preparation.
